Output 51f2c304d17dd17e74a3d3a6a81296d5c924c6d55561e2b9bfa15e5438cc009d:1

value
5231200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dbe9be04bdc2b23742fcd863b0723159daf9ae4 OP_EQUAL
address
3LStnc9yHQfmNjgvYK1A1ZhPijn9AmLEjz
transaction
51f2c304d17dd17e74a3d3a6a81296d5c924c6d55561e2b9bfa15e5438cc009d
spent
true